The Children's Music Program offers music activities for children under the name Children's Music Program. The program meets on Thursdays and runs in the late afternoon and early evening.

• Schedule: Thursdays from 4:30pm to 6:00pm

The Children's Music Program is part of The Salvation Army Napa Corps and is led within the broader structure of Salvation Army programs. Salvation Army programs are led by Salvation Army Officers, who assess needs, deliver programs, and direct ministries for the local community. At this corps, they function as the Executive Directors and the Pastors. The leadership team includes Captains Larry and Gloria Carmichael, along with Napa church leaders and pastors Josh and Jill. The Salvation Army describes itself as an international movement and an evangelical part of the universal Christian Church, with a message based on the Bible and a ministry motivated by the love of God. Its mission is to preach the gospel of Jesus Christ and to meet human needs in His name without discrimination. The Salvation Army is a nonprofit organization offering services in over 120 countries around the world and in every zip code of the United States.
